From the 3DS Launch thread:
2. When new Miis appear in the Mii Plaza via StreetPass, exiting the Mii Plaza or going to the entrance to retrieve more new Miis before utilizing them in StreetPass Puzzle or StreetPass Quest forfeits their help. New StreetPass arrivals are limited to 10 people at a time. In Japan, the Mii Plaza was not explained in the manual itself, but briefly outlined in an additional leaflet.
